About this episode

Dan Barnett interviews Geoff Rowe about the first Live Comedy Day and the initiatives of the Live Comedy Association.

Latest episode is with Geoff Rowe of the Live Comedy Association We talk about the first Live Comedy Day which takes place on April 1st as well as the wider aims of the Live Comedy Association in both acting as a network for the industry and also acting as a united front for the industry when dealing with the government. We also discuss the Live Comedy Survey conducted by Brunel University on the Live Comedy Sector as well as comparison with organisations in other sectors such as the Music Venue Trust.
